Why was Socrates sentenced to death?
Socrates is one of the most famous philosophies in the classical Greek. Also, he is the founder of Western philosophy. However, he was sentenced to death when he was in 70 years old. Socrates was accused of two charges; the first one is he believes other Gods in his city and the second is corrupted the youth. Religion was really important in classical Greek; everyone respected and obeyed their God in the city. Socrates tried to better understand that, and he always believed what he believed. Socrates gave many questions about people’s belief, and the youth found that Socrates’ idea were very interesting and intelligent. Socrates shared his idea to the youth. His idea and thinking were attracted by a lot of youth. The city found that Socrates was a threat, and if Socrates continued to do it, people would turnover their belief and rule. So, the city decided to put Socrates to death.
